Audi SQ8 Sportback e-tron (21/22 inch wheels) MPG by year — every rating on record

The Audi SQ8 Sportback e-tron (21/22 inch wheels) has a combined EPA fuel economy rating for 2 model years, from 2024 to 2025. Across those years its best rated version returned 63 mpg (2024) and its thirstiest returned 60 mpg (2025). The EPA record holds 2 configurations for this nameplate, most recently a Standard Sport Utility Vehicle 4WD.

In the EPA record this nameplate also appears as SQ8 Sportback e-tron (21/22 inch wheels) and SQ8 e-tron (21/22 inch wheels). The figures below cover every one of them.

Where it has stood in its class

Ranked against every other nameplate the EPA filed under the same class that year. The Audi SQ8 Sportback e-tron (21/22 inch wheels) placed highest in 2024 at #46 of 166, and lowest in 2025 at #59 of 192. It spent 2 of its 2 ranked years in the top half of its class.
